首页文章正文

逆波兰式转换规则的推导过程,强制类型转换规则

波兰表示法 2023-12-31 17:45 214 墨鱼
波兰表示法

逆波兰式转换规则的推导过程,强制类型转换规则

转换:将中缀表达式依据优先级关系括起来,将运算符移到对应括号的前方,去掉括号,即得波兰表达式。计算:对于一个波兰表达式的求值而言,首先要从右至左扫描表达式试为表达式w+(a+b)*(c+d/(e-10)+8) 写出相应的逆波兰表示。解:w a b + c d e 10 - / + 8 + * + 按照三种基本控制结构文法将下面的语句翻译成四元式序列:wh

直接法:直接接受扩充式语言,并按语言的语义规则处理。间接法:接受串行源程序(或带并行指示标志的串行源程序),并行编译程序对源程序进行并行性检查,将检测到的并行成分转换成C.最左推导和最右推导必定相同D.可能存在两个不同的最左推导,但他们对应的语法树相同57、B)不是DFA的成分A.有穷字母表B.多个初始状态的集合C.多个终态的集合D.转换函数58、与逆波兰式(后

3、逆波兰式生成的实验设计思想及算法(1)首先构造一个运算符栈,此运算符在栈内遵循越往栈顶优先级越高的原则。2)读入一个用中缀表示的简单算术表达式,为方便起见,设该简单而逆波兰式又名后缀表达式,后缀表达式比中缀表达式计算起来更方便简单些,中缀表达式要计算就存在着括号的匹配问题,所以在计算表达式值时一般都是先转换成后缀

整理流程:NULLABLE集(能推出ε的非终结符的集合)->FIRST(N)集(从非终结符N推导的句子开头的所有可能的终结符的集合)->FOLLOW(N)集(紧跟在非终结符N后面的终结(4)将S1中的所有符号除‘’以外都push到S2中这样我们就得到了一个逆波兰序列计算结果:将逆波兰式依次堆入一个栈中,如果堆入的是一个运算符,取出栈里的头两

后台-插件-广告管理-内容页尾部广告(手机)

标签: 强制类型转换规则

发表评论

评论列表

灯蓝加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号